Warning Signs You Need Broken Pipe Water Removal

Don’t wait until it’s too late to address the warning signs of a burst pipe. If you notice any of the following signs, it’s time to call our team for Broken Pipe Water Remov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, musty odors can be a sign of a burst pipe or water damage. If you notice a persistent smell in your home, it’s time to investigate and address the issue before it gets worse.

Water Stains or Warping on Walls or Floors

Water stains or warping on walls or floors can be a sign of a burst pipe or water damage. If you notice any of these signs, it’s time to act quickly to prevent further damage.

Increased Water Bills

Increased water bills can be a sign of a burst pipe or water damage. If you notice a sudden spike in your water bills, it’s time to investigate and address the issue before it gets worse.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as water pooling or flooding, is a clear sign that you need Broken Pipe Water Removal. Don’t wait until it’s too late to address the issue and get your home back to normal.

Discoloration or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Discoloration or stains on ceilings or walls can be a sign of a burst pipe or water damage. If you notice any of these signs, it’s time to investigate and address the issue before it gets worse.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can be a sign of a burst pipe or water damage. If you notice any of these signs, it’s time to act quickly to prevent further damage.

Broken Pipe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en Yes No You can likely fix the leak yourself with a wrench and some basic plumbing knowledge.
Large flood or extensive water damage No Yes A large flood or extensive water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to properly clean and restore your home.
Unknown source of the leak No Yes If you’re not sure where the leak is coming from, it’s best to call a professional to help you identify and fix the issue.
Water damage affecting multiple rooms or floors No Yes Extensive water damage needs a comprehensive approach to clean and restore your home, which is best handled by a professional.
Insurance claim involved No Yes If you have an insurance claim involved, it’s best to call a professional to help you navigate the process and ensure a smooth claims experience.

Broken Pipe Water Removal Cost In Weymouth, MA

The cost of Broken Pipe Water Removal in Weymouth, MA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and other local factors. Our team will work with you to provide a customized estimate for the work that needs to be done.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 The amount of water extracted and the equipment needed to do so.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of equipment needed to dry it out.
Cleaning and restoration $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ed to restore your home.
Final inspection and completion $500 – $2,000 The complexity of the job and the amount of time required to complete it.

Common Questions About Broken Pipe Water Removal

Q: What causes a burst pipe?

A: A burst pipe can be caused by a variety of factors, including freezing temperatures, aging pipes, and corrosion. Our team will work with you to identify the source of the issue and provide a customized solution.
